The video tutorial covers arithmetic with rational numbers, focusing on the order of operations using PEMDAS. It provides examples to illustrate the correct sequence of operations. The tutorial also explains the difference between rational and irrational numbers, offering examples of each. Additionally, it discusses methods for ordering and comparing rational numbers, including the use of inequalities. The video aims to enhance understanding of these mathematical concepts, preparing students for exams.
